solution home » services » solution In-Rem Review Board HearingThe In Rem Review Board is composed of (5) five members. Each member is a City of Atlanta resident, nominated by the Mayor and confirmed by the Council. The In Rem Board hearings are held the (4th) fourth Thursday each month (pending there is a required quorum which is at least 3 members of the board and holiday schedule). Prior to the hearing, several actions must take place:  • The owner or parties in interest must be notified though a newspaper advertisement, filing a Lis pendes, and notice send to each owner.  • Photos are taken of the entire property.  • Inspection forms are complie, as well as an agenda which is sent to the board members as well as the managers/supervisors and council member. The day of the hearing there are signing sheets for every person in attendance. The Board Chair calls the hearing to order, and all witnessing persons are sworn in. The Board Chairman calls the agenda and the City presents its evidence for each property The Board then votes on whether the property can be demolished or clean and closed.This Article was created on: 02/23/2014This Article was last updated on: 08/20/2020
